Two weeks into my first experience with an Android phone (HTC Desire) - I am impressed. Its amazingly slick at running apps/tasks. Everything is really good, so far.
Deals on Android phones in the UK are pretty amazing. I got my HTC Desire free on an 18 month contract @ £25 a month. For an Iphone ... I would have had to hand some cash upfront - I think the equivalent deal for Iphone requires nearly £200 for the phone ... + the 18 month contract price.
